How Land Rover Defender Vintage Models: Restoration Costs and Process Actually Works
Understanding Land Rover Defender Vintage Models: Restoration Costs and Process begins with seeing it as a structured project rather than a simple repair. The process typically starts with a careful assessment of the vehicleโs condition, often called a pre-purchase inspection if you are buying a project, or a personal audit if you already own one. This step identifies rust, worn suspension components, fatigue in the chassis, and the state of the interior and electrical systems. From this evaluation, a realistic plan and budget can be formed, separating critical safety repairs from cosmetic improvements. It is a methodical process that prioritizes the integrity of the vehicleโs core structure before moving on to the details that give it character.
Once the assessment is complete, the restoration work moves into stages. Many owners choose a full frame-off rebuild, which involves completely stripping the vehicle down to its core chassis. This allows for thorough rust treatment, replacement of compromised panels, and a fresh paint job that protects the vehicle for years. Others might opt for a more focused restoration, addressing only the most pressing mechanical or safety issues while maintaining the vehicleโs original patina. For Land Rover Defender Vintage Models: Restoration Costs and Process, mechanical work is often a central pillar. This can include rebuilding or replacing the original diesel or petrol engines, refreshing the transfer case, and installing modern braking and suspension components that enhance safety without destroying the classic feel. The goal is to respect the design of the vintage model while ensuring it meets current standards for reliability and drivability.
Common Questions People Have About Land Rover Defender Vintage Models: Restoration Costs and Process
How much does a full restoration of a vintage Defender typically cost?
The cost of restoring a vintage Defender can vary dramatically based on the model year, condition of the starting vehicle, and the level of completion desired. A basic mechanical refresh and cosmetic update might range into the low tens of thousands of dollars, while a comprehensive, barn-find restoration to a show-quality condition can reach well over $100,000. Factors such as the cost of parts, labor rates for specialist shops, and the need to source rare components all contribute to the final figure. It is important to view this not as a simple expense but as a significant investment in a durable asset that can appreciate with thoughtful care.
Are the parts easy to find, and is the process very complicated?
While the Defender has a massive global community supporting it, finding exact original equipment manufacturer (OEM) parts can sometimes require patience and research. Many turn to aftermarket specialists who reproduce components to original specifications, which can be a more accessible route. The complexity of the restoration is often tied to the skill of the builder or the shop they choose. For the average DIY enthusiast, smaller tasks like interior retrimming or repainting bumpers are very achievable. However, major structural work and mechanical overhauls are best left to professionals with specific experience in these vehicles. The process demands time, patience, and a willingness to learn, which is part of the appeal for many owners.

What should I look for when buying a project Defender?
When considering a project vehicle, a meticulous inspection is the most important step. Look for signs of previous repairs, the quality of past work, and any evidence of persistent rust, particularly in the wheel arches, sills, and underbody. A clear service history, if available, provides valuable insight into the vehicleโs past. It is also wise to verify the legality of the vehicle in your state, ensuring it can be registered and insured for road use. Ultimately, the best project is one where the seller is transparent about the work needed, allowing you to enter the restoration with your eyes open and a realistic plan.

Things People Often Misunderstand
A common misconception is that all older Defenders are fragile and unreliable. In reality, the simple, robust engineering of these vehicles often means they outlast more complex modern machines when properly maintained. Another misunderstanding is that restoration is always about returning the vehicle to a showroom-fresh state. Many enthusiasts actually prefer a "period correct" approach that maintains some wear and tear, celebrating the truck's history rather than erasing it. There is also a belief that only experts can work on these trucks, when in fact, the widespread availability of information and parts makes it more accessible than ever for dedicated beginners to learn and contribute to the process.
